diff --git a/src/main/java/org/qortal/at/AT.java b/src/main/java/org/qortal/at/AT.java index 99ae57d5..005bb0cd 100644 --- a/src/main/java/org/qortal/at/AT.java +++ b/src/main/java/org/qortal/at/AT.java @@ -131,8 +131,10 @@ public class AT { // Nothing happened? if (state.getSteps() == 0 && Arrays.equals(stateHash, latestAtStateData.getStateHash())) - // this.atStateData will be null - return Collections.emptyList(); + // We currently want to execute frozen ATs, to maintain backwards support. + if (state.isFrozen() == false) + // this.atStateData will be null + return Collections.emptyList(); long atFees = api.calcFinalFees(state); Long sleepUntilMessageTimestamp = this.atData.getSleepUntilMessageTimestamp();